Re: DTASwin rewrite
With interpolation off, the ECU will notify you when you are in the middle of each block, based on the settings Rob has highlighted above. You will get the green blocks when you are within these limits.
If you are mapping, interpolation must be off.
If it's on, the ECU assumes you are not mapping and simply driving, so the cross hairs move to each cell as soon as the threshold is breached.
I plan to modify the cross hairs, they are not clear enough.
